One Dead, Three Security Officers Injured in Violent Clash Near Dominase Onion Market

A violent confrontation between security personnel and suspected criminals near the Dominase Onion Market in the Central Region has resulted in the death of one civilian and injuries to three security officers.

The incident occurred in the Gomoa East District during a raid targeting suspected armed robbers believed to be behind a series of attacks along the Kasoa-Winneba Highway.

The operation, authorized by the Gomoa East District Security Council in collaboration with the Central East Regional Police Command, was part of a broader effort to clamp down on criminal activity in the area.

Eyewitnesses say tensions escalated when security officers began demolishing makeshift shelters suspected to be harboring criminals—often referred to locally as “ghetto boys.” During the raid, officers reportedly seized weapons and illegal drugs from some suspects.

Tragedy struck when one civilian, allegedly linked to the group, was killed during the demolition exercise. His death triggered a violent retaliation from the suspects, who attacked security personnel using machetes, stones, and sticks.

The clash left two police officers and one immigration officer injured. They are currently receiving medical attention at the Gomoa Potsin Polyclinic and the Winneba Trauma and Specialist Hospital.

Amid the chaos, two drip machines were vandalized, and a police patrol vehicle was damaged by the assailants.

In response, the Gomoa East District Assembly and police authorities condemned the attack and assured the public that investigations are ongoing. They also pledged to bring the perpetrators to justice and restore order to the area.
